Temperature diagnosis
(as of February 2007)
An additional temperature diagnosis can be activated in
the ROPEX visualization software (
"Diagnostic interface / visualization software (as of
February 2007)" on page 43). The RES-409 checks
whether the ACTUAL temperature is within a settable
tolerance band ("OK" window) either side of the SET
temperature. The lower (
) and upper
(
) tolerance band limits are configured in the
factory to -10K and +10K. These values can be set
independently of one another in the ROPEX
visualization software.
If the ACTUAL temperature is inside the specified
tolerance band when a START command is sent via the
CAN interface - or a 24VDC signal (START 0 or
START 1) is activated - the temperature diagnosis is
also activated. If the ACTUAL temperature leaves the
tolerance band, the corresponding error code
(307 or 308) is indicated and the fault output is
switched (
section 10.16 "Error messages" on
If the temperature diagnosis is not activated by the time
the "START" signal is deactivated (i.e. if the ACTUAL
temperature does not exceed the upper or lower
tolerance band limit), the corresponding error code
(309 or 310) is indicated and the fault relay is switched.
An additional delay time (0..9.9s) can be set via the
CAN interface (CAN message address 10) or in the
ROPEX visualization software. The first time the lower
tolerance band limit is exceeded, the temperature
diagnosis is not activated until the parameterized delay
time has elapsed. The temperature diagnosis function
can thus be selectively deactivated, e.g. if the
temperature drops temporarily because the sealing
jaws are closed.
The values that can be set in the ROPEX
visualization software for the upper and
lower tolerance band are identical to those for the
"Temperature OK" bit. These values are
transferred with CAN message address 7 (or
addresses D and E).
10.11
Heatup timeout
(as of February 2007)
An additional heatup timeout can be activated either in
the ROPEX visualization software (
"Diagnostic interface / visualization software (as of
February 2007)" on page 43) or via the CAN interface
(CAN message address 11). This timeout starts as
soon as any START command is received via the CAN
interface (or the 24VDC START 0 signal is activated).
The RES-409 then monitors the time required for the
ACTUAL temperature to reach 95% of the SET
temperature. If this time is longer than the
